Shekhar Suman’s Unforgettable Bike Ride with Madhuri Dixit and a Frugal Makeup Tale

Shekhar Suman recalls riding Madhuri Dixit on a motorcycle; wife Alka handled her makeup because of tight finances

In a candid chat, Shekhar Suman shares a quirky memory of scooting Madhuri Dixit on a bike and how his wife Alka stepped in to do her makeup when money was tight.

During a recent television interview, veteran actor‑comedian Shekhar Suman let slip a story that many fans have never heard before – the time he literally picked up Madhuri Dixit on a motorcycle. It sounded like something straight out of a Bollywood movie, but the seasoned performer said it was all too real.

“We were shooting in a remote location, and the logistics were a mess,” Shekhar recalled, chuckling. “The crew didn’t have a proper vehicle to move the stars around, so I hopped on my bike and gave Madhuri a lift. Imagine that – the ‘Dream Girl’ perched on a motorbike with a big grin on her face!” He added that the whole incident turned into a light‑hearted moment on set, with everyone bursting into laughter.

But the anecdote didn’t stop at the bike ride. Shekhar went on to explain how his wife, Alka, became an unlikely makeup artist for the star. “We were on a shoestring budget,” he said, his tone slipping into a softer, more reflective register. “The production couldn’t afford a professional makeup crew for the day, and Madhuri, being ever‑so gracious, didn’t mind at all.”

Alka, who had a knack for cosmetics despite never having worked in the film industry, stepped in with a few basic tools. “I used what we had – a bit of foundation, a powder compact, and a trusty eyeliner. It wasn’t fancy, but it did the job,” Alka recalled later, laughing at the memory.

Both Shekhar and Alka emphasized that the episode highlighted a different side of Bollywood – one where stars are just people, sometimes relying on the kindness of friends and the improvisation of a supportive spouse. “Those days taught us that creativity and camaraderie can fill the gaps left by a limited budget,” Shekhar mused.

The story resonated with many viewers, sparking a wave of comments about the humility and resilience of film crews working under constraints. For Shekhar Suman, it’s another reminder of the unpredictable, often heart‑warming moments that happen behind the cameras.
